Mastering Time Management: Essential Skills for Professional Success
In today's fast-paced work environment, mastering time management is crucial for achieving professional success. Effective time management skills not only help individuals meet deadlines and accomplish tasks efficiently but also lead to increased productivity and reduced stress levels. Let's delve into the essential skills that can help you excel in your career:
1. Prioritization
One of the fundamental aspects of time management is prioritizing tasks. Identify urgent and important tasks and allocate your time and energy accordingly. Use techniques like the Eisenhower Matrix to categorize tasks based on their importance and urgency.
2. Goal Setting
Set clear and achievable goals for yourself. Break down larger goals into smaller, actionable steps to make them more manageable. Having well-defined objectives provides direction and motivation to stay focused on your tasks.
3. Planning and Scheduling
Create a daily or weekly schedule outlining your tasks and deadlines. Use tools like calendars, planners, or digital apps to organize your time effectively. Allocate specific time blocks for different activities to ensure a structured approach to your workday.
4. Delegation
Learn to delegate tasks that can be handled by others. Delegating not only frees up your time for more critical responsibilities but also fosters teamwork and collaboration within the workplace. Trusting your colleagues with tasks can help you focus on high-priority activities.
5. Avoiding Procrastination
Procrastination can be a significant obstacle to effective time management. Identify the reasons behind your procrastination and work on strategies to overcome it. Break tasks into smaller chunks, set deadlines, and eliminate distractions to boost your productivity.
6. Time Tracking and Evaluation
Regularly track how you spend your time and evaluate your productivity. Identify time-wasting activities and areas for improvement. Reflect on your accomplishments and challenges to optimize your time management strategies continuously.
7. Continuous Learning and Adaptation
Time management is a skill that evolves over time. Stay updated on best practices, tools, and techniques for efficient time management. Be open to trying new approaches and adapting your strategies based on feedback and outcomes.

By honing these essential time management skills, you can enhance your productivity, reduce stress, and pave the way for professional success. Remember that effective time management is not about doing more in less time but about doing the right things at the right time.
